<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
AFLAC Inc.                     COM              001055102     1360 34130.0000SH      SOLE               34130.0000
Affiliated Computer Systems    COM              008190100     3322 55185.0000SH      SOLE               55185.0000
American International Group I COM              026874107     4197 63910.0000SH      SOLE               63910.0000
Amgen                          COM              031162100     1277 19901.0000SH      SOLE               19901.0000
BP Amoco PLC ADR               COM              055622104     4117 70502.0000SH      SOLE               70502.0000
Bank of New York Co. Inc       COM              064057102     2480 74200.0000SH      SOLE               74200.0000
Bemis                          COM              081437105     2986 102640.0000SH     SOLE              102640.0000
Cardiodynamics Intl CP         COM              141597104      102 19640.0000SH      SOLE               19640.0000
Chevron Texaco Corp.           COM              166764100     3490 66461.7017SH      SOLE               66461.7017
Chunghwa Telecom Co. Ltd       COM              17133q205     1476 70110.0000SH      SOLE               70110.0000
Cisco Systems Inc.             COM              17275R102     1659 85844.0000SH      SOLE               85844.0000
Citigroup                      COM              172967101     2973 61703.2925SH      SOLE               61703.2925
Coca Cola                      COM              191216100      236 5675.0000SH       SOLE                5675.0000
Colgate-Palmolive Co.          COM              194162103     1438 28100.0000SH      SOLE               28100.0000
Computer Sciences Corp.        COM              205363104      929 16480.0000SH      SOLE               16480.0000
ConocoPhillips                 COM              20825C104     3399 39140.0000SH      SOLE               39140.0000
Constellation Brands Inc.      COM              21036p108      442 9500.0000SH       SOLE                9500.0000
Costco Whsl Group              COM              22160K105     1597 32990.0000SH      SOLE               32990.0000
Cubic Corporation              COM              229669106      278 11100.0000SH      SOLE               11100.0000
DeVry, Inc.                    COM              251893103      781 45000.0000SH      SOLE               45000.0000
Electronic Arts, Inc.          COM              285512109     1049 17010.0000SH      SOLE               17010.0000
Exelon  Corporation            COM              30161n101     2316 52550.0000SH      SOLE               52550.0000
Exxon Mobil                    COM              30231G102      789 15388.0000SH      SOLE               15388.0000
Family Dollar Stores           COM              307000109     2273 72775.0000SH      SOLE               72775.0000
Fifth Third Bancorp            COM              316773100      749 15835.0000SH      SOLE               15835.0000
Fomento Economico Mexicano     COM              344419106     1000 19000.0000SH      SOLE               19000.0000
Gannett Co. Inc.               COM              364730101     1717 21010.0000SH      SOLE               21010.0000
General Electric               COM              369604103     3231 88509.0709SH      SOLE               88509.0709
GlaxoSmithKline plc            COM              37733W105     2142 45200.0000SH      SOLE               45200.0000
Goldman Sachs Group            COM              38141G104     2243 21555.0000SH      SOLE               21555.0000
Great Plains Energy            COM              391164100      701 23140.0000SH      SOLE               23140.0000
Honda Motor Corp.              COM              438128308     1379 52935.0000SH      SOLE               52935.0000
IBM                            COM              459200101     1529 15511.4001SH      SOLE               15511.4001
Jefferson Pilot                COM              475070108     1706 32840.0000SH      SOLE               32840.0000
Johnson & Johnson              COM              478160104     4612 72721.0000SH      SOLE               72721.0000
Kinder Morgan Management LLC   COM              49455u100     1173 28827.2864SH      SOLE               28827.2864
Korea Electric Power           COM              500631106     1193 90095.0000SH      SOLE               90095.0000
L-3 Communications             COM              502424104     1983 27070.0000SH      SOLE               27070.0000
Lowe's Companies Inc.          COM              548661107     2955 51315.2477SH      SOLE               51315.2477
MBNA Corp.                     COM              55262L100     2127 75450.0000SH      SOLE               75450.0000
Medtronic, Inc.                COM              585055106     4148 83507.7411SH      SOLE               83507.7411
Merrill Lynch                  COM              590188108     2867 47965.0000SH      SOLE               47965.0000
Microsoft Corp.                COM              594918104     3307 123761.4533SH     SOLE              123761.4533
Nestle S A Sponsored Registere COM              641069406     1909 29180.0000SH      SOLE               29180.0000
Pepsico Inc.                   COM              713448108     3616 69270.0000SH      SOLE               69270.0000
Pfizer                         COM              717081103     3497 130037.0000SH     SOLE              130037.0000
Pharmaceutical HOLDRs Trust    COM              71712a206      363 5000.0000SH       SOLE                5000.0000
Procter & Gamble               COM              742718109     2007 36434.0000SH      SOLE               36434.0000
Qualcomm                       COM              747525103     2784 65662.0021SH      SOLE               65662.0021
S&P Depository Receipts ETF    COM              78462F103      250 2065.0000SH       SOLE                2065.0000
SEI Investments                COM              784117103      688 16420.0000SH      SOLE               16420.0000
SK Telecom Co. Ltd             COM              78440p108      909 40845.0000SH      SOLE               40845.0000
Sony Corp. ADR New             COM              835699307      656 16835.0000SH      SOLE               16835.0000
Starbucks Inc.                 COM              855244109      785 12590.0000SH      SOLE               12590.0000
State Street Corp.             COM              857477103     4169 84870.0000SH      SOLE               84870.0000
SunGard Data Systems Inc       COM              867363103     2967 104730.0000SH     SOLE              104730.0000
Sunrise Assisted Living        COM              86768K106     2879 62100.0000SH      SOLE               62100.0000
Suntrust Banks Inc.            COM              867914103      460 6228.0000SH       SOLE                6228.0000
Sysco Corporation              COM              871829107      294 7695.0000SH       SOLE                7695.0000
TJX Co Inc.                    COM              872540109      777 30915.0000SH      SOLE               30915.0000
Telecom Corp. of New Zealand   COM              879278208      622 17545.0000SH      SOLE               17545.0000
Teva Pharmaceutical Industries COM              881624209      995 33325.0000SH      SOLE               33325.0000
UnitedHealth Group             COM              91324P102     3854 43775.0000SH      SOLE               43775.0000
Verizon Communications         COM              92343V104      250 6164.0000SH       SOLE                6164.0000
WPP Group                      COM              929309300     2264 41415.0000SH      SOLE               41415.0000
Walt Disney Co's.              COM              254687106     1094 39365.0000SH      SOLE               39365.0000
Wells Fargo New                COM              949746101      214 3440.0000SH       SOLE                3440.0000
Wyeth                          COM              983024100      263 6183.0000SH       SOLE                6183.0000
Xilinx                         COM              983919101      693 23360.0000SH      SOLE               23360.0000
Zions Bancorporation           COM              989701107      567 8330.0000SH       SOLE                8330.0000
iShares Mid-Cap Barra Value    COM              464287705      285 2220.0000SH       SOLE                2220.0000
iShares Nasdaq Biotech Index   COM              464287556     1673 22190.0000SH      SOLE               22190.0000
iShares US Financial           COM              464287788      211 2160.0000SH       SOLE                2160.0000
Citigroup 6.231% Preferred Ser PFT              172967705      521 9790.0000SH       SOLE                9790.0000
Consolidated Edison Preferred  PFT              209115203      980 36565.0000SH      SOLE               36565.0000
MBNA Preferred E Series        PFT              55270B201      425 15515.0000SH      SOLE               15515.0000
Equity Residential Properties  REL              29476l107     1236 34155.0000SH      SOLE               34155.0000
</TABLE>